Abstract

TRIZ theory is a set of systematic innovation methodology and invention problem solving theory. It is a comprehensive theoretical system composed of various methods to solve technical problems and realize innovation. System components analysis of the water washing tower, located in the olefin separation unit of coal-to-methanol plant, was carried out using the TRIZ theory. The interaction of the components of the water wash tower system and the resulting causal chain are analysed. By the principle of the characteristics transfer invention and contradiction analysis, the solutions to solve the problem of blocked washing tower are initially proposed in the paper.
